Mr Nick Raynsford NS7 To move the following Schedule:
'SCHEDULEThe Private Hire Vehicles (London) Act 19981. The Private Hire Vehicles (London) Act 1998 shall be amended as follows.2. Except in sections 37, 38 and 40, for "Secretary of State", wherever occurring, there shall be substituted "licensing authority". 3. In section 3(3) (grant of London operator's licences) for "he" there shall be substituted "the authority". 4. In section 7(2) (grant of London PHV licences) for "he" there shall be substituted "the authority". 5. In section 8(2) (presentation of vehicle for inspection and testing) for "he" there shall be substituted "the authority". 6. In section 10(3) (exemption from exhibiting disc or plate) for "he" there shall be substituted "the authority". 7.(1) Section 13 (London PHV driver's licences) shall be amended as follows. (2) In subsection (2) (grant of London PHV driver's licence) for "he" there shall be substituted "the authority".
